The Challenges of Selling an Empty House in Ocala
Selling an empty house in Ocala comes with its own set of hurdles. One of the primary challenges is the lack of visual appeal that furnished homes naturally possess. When potential buyers walk into an empty space, it can be difficult for them to envision themselves living there. The absence of furniture and personal touches can make rooms appear smaller and less inviting.
Additionally, empty houses may develop maintenance issues that go unnoticed without regular occupancy. In Ocala’s climate, where heat and humidity can take a toll on properties, this can be particularly problematic. Vacant homes may also raise security concerns, as they can be more susceptible to vandalism or break-ins, potentially deterring prospective buyers.
Ocala’s Unique Real Estate Landscape
Ocala’s real estate market has some distinctive characteristics that can influence how empty houses are perceived and valued. The city offers a diverse range of property types, from single-family homes to condos and townhouses, which means that buyers may have different expectations when viewing properties. This diversity can work in favor of some empty houses, especially those with standout features or prime locations.
Additionally, Ocala’s relatively affordable median listing price of around $300,000 could make empty houses more attractive to buyers looking for value or investment opportunities. The moderate pace of sales, with homes typically staying on the market for about 70 days, suggests that sellers of empty houses may need to be patient and strategic in their approach.
Overcoming the Empty House Stigma in Ocala’s Market
Despite the challenges, there are effective ways to overcome the empty house stigma in Ocala’s real estate market. Professional staging can work wonders in transforming a vacant property into an inviting space that potential buyers can connect with. By strategically placing furniture and decor, stagers can highlight the home’s best features and help buyers visualize its potential.
In Ocala, where outdoor living is often a significant draw, emphasizing the property’s exterior appeal can also be a game-changer. Showcasing well-maintained landscaping, outdoor entertainment areas, or proximity to Ocala’s natural attractions can shift the focus away from an empty interior and onto the lifestyle opportunities the property offers. Additionally, competitive pricing and highlighting unique features of the home or neighborhood can help attract potential buyers despite the property being empty.
